What if I was injured in a car accident while a passenger in someone else’s vehicle?
If you were injured as a passenger in someone else’s vehicle in a car accident in Texas, you may be able to file a claim for damages. Texas is a “fault” state, which means that the driver who caused the accident is financially responsible for any damages and injuries resulting from the crash. As the passenger, you might have grounds for a personal injury claim against the driver who was found negligent in causing the accident. In order to build a case for damages, you will need to have evidence to show that you were injured due to the other driver’s negligence. This can include medical evidence of injuries, eyewitness accounts, or photos taken at the scene of the accident. You may also need to prove that the negligent driver’s actions directly caused the injuries that you suffered. If the driver who caused the accident has insurance, the insurance company will likely pay for your medical bills and cover any lost wages due to time missed from work. Depending on the severity of the injuries, you may also be entitled to financial compensation for pain and suffering. In Texas, the statute of limitations for filing a personal injury claim is two years, so it is important that you seek legal advice and act quickly if you were injured in a car accident as a passenger. An experienced personal injury attorney can help you determine the best course of action and negotiate a fair settlement for your injuries.
